Vous êtes sur la page 1sur 11

Lovely Professional University

Software Project Case Study:


Automation of Gas Agency (Home Refill Booking Module)

December 20th February 5th Lovely Professional University


To: MR. Ram Singh BY:

Abhishek Singh

Mr. Abhishek Singh Rathore D1006A06 11005978

Overview :
1.
2. 3. 4. 5.

Setting the Stage Questionnaires Task Management Existing System & Environment Proposed System User Interface Database Design Flow Chart Development of Requirements

1.

2.

Operations

3. Summary & Lesson Learned

Abhishek Singh

Setting the stage:


I am going to develop the gas refilling module and I found it quite interesting and familiar because we use this service in our homes also so working on it can be taken as easy because we have little knowledge about how it really operates. But I need to develop the whole module and need to provide it some standard for this I worked on it. For increasing the knowledge on this project I visited a GAS AGENCY. I saw the employee working there software and tried to understand them.

Develop the whole software for SONDHI gas agency.

Interviewing P eoples:
For better understanding the problem it would be better thing to become a part of environment where the problem exists. So I asked few question to the Senior Manager of the Agency ( Mr. Promod Sharma ) and they were : Question 1 :

Would you tell me what happens here in a typical day?

Ans: He told,the current software is totally designed according to the need of our day to day operations like: 1. 2. 3. 4. 5. Gas Booking New Connection Cancellation Transfer of Connection Stock maintenance

He added also this software makes thing easier to them and save their lot of time. They can easily do their work by using it. Question 2:

How do you feel about the situation?

Ans: He said, every day they have to deal with a lots of customers with different problems and they must be solved at any cost. So demand such a software what can really help them . Abhishek Singh

Question 3:

What is your impression of the software?

Ans: he said, their agency got a user friendly and fast processing software. They dont need to worry about the logical stuff they can easily deal with the work efficiently. It is obvious that if a huge company is making a software than they will take care about such things also.

Tasks Definition:
The whole situation is understood and problem is defined. In the development phase I will perform the following tasks.
1.

Define the boundaries and scope: the boundaries of


the software must be defined otherwise the requirements will not end and at the end the customer will not be satisfied with the software because the technology changes so fast so we need some specification on it. In this project I will only design a module for the GAS BOOKING this will going to be my boundary.

2.

Divide and conquer: The problem is divided into the modules to


that it will be easier to manage the problem and without any inconsistency I will get the better result at the end of development. I divided it in the following manner : a. Analysis of existing software b. Create a UI(user interface) c. Coding d. Database Connectivity e. Security f. Testing g. Release

Existing System: The existing software on which SODHI GAS AGENCY is currently working, I got some snap shots. These will be helpful for better understanding and creating the software.

Abhishek Singh

a. Home Module:

b. Refill Module:

Abhishek Singh

c. Customer Details:

Abhishek Singh

Proposed System:
Prototype: till today I have developed some of interface and gone through with some of SQL CONNECTIVITY. I am using the ITERATIVE/INCREMENTAL MODEL.
Abhishek Singh

User interface:

Booking module:

Database Design:
Table One_ USER: It contains the information of the consumers.

Abhishek Singh

Table two _ INFO: It contains the information of consumers regarding their addresses and delivery of cylinders.

Flow Chart:
STA True IS ACCEPT False CALL EXITMAIN FORM SCREEN DISPLAY FLASH PASSWORD RT APPLICATION PASSWORD==TRUE

Abhishek Singh

Architectural and detailed designs:


1. SOFTWARE REQUIREMENTS:
The software being used for the development of this project is: OPERATING SYSTEM ENVIORNMENT .NET FRAMEWORK LANGUAGE BACKEND
2.

: Windows7 Professional : Visual Studio.Net 2010 : Version2.0 : Visual C# : SQL SERVER 2008

HARDWARE REQUIREMENTS:

The hardware used for the development of the project is: PROCESSOR : INTEL COREI3 RAM : 3GB HARD DISK : 350GB KEYBOARD : 102KEYS

Operations:
I will use INCREMENT PROTOTYPE MODEL. Every time a new and more functional model will be produced by changing in the current model so that in very short amount of time I will get a good project. SQL SERVER 2010 is used for the data storage so among tables referencing is done for creating relations between the tables.

Abhishek Singh

Summary:
This project comprises all the operations for booking gas. This project deals with vast amount of data. A huge and satisfactory work will be done for the completion.

Abhishek Singh

Vous aimerez peut-être aussi